The Virginia Zoo in Norfolk is seeking to hire an enthusiastic and experienced Lead Zookeeper of Americas/Zoo Farm. Zookeeper positions play an essential role in animal care, welfare and ensuring safe working environments at the zoo where we maintain many rare, endangered and potentially dangerous animals. This position is a field supervisory position that leads the Americas/Zoo Farm area team of zookeepers in the Animal Services department. The position carries out essential tasks directly, also serves to teach, mentor and ensure good performance of zookeepers doing the same. This position is essential for animal care, health, hygiene and welfare; as well as to ensure that a good standard of presentation is maintained for our nearly 500,000 visitors to the zoo each year.

Essential Functions

Essential functions include but are not limited to:

  • Provides experienced husbandry care for the mammals and birds in the Americas/Zoo Farm collection at the Virginia Zoo directly and supervises other zookeepers, interns and volunteers in doing the same.
  • Coordinates behavioral training and enrichment programs for the mammals and birds in the Americas/Zoo Farm collection, implements breeding protocols, assists veterinarian with physical examinations, and observing behavior.
  • Ensures good facilities maintenance and display standards for the Americas/Zoo Farm exhibits and surrounding public spaces including area theming.
  • Undertakes daily cleaning and maintaining of exhibits and exhibit areas, service areas and animal holding units, utilizing various tools, instruments, disinfectants; with the ability to do so safely and supervise others to do the same.
  • Performs administrative duties by keeping records on animal behavior and exhibit repairs, maintaining inventory, filling out paperwork and surveys, serving as the Institutional Representative for various SSP’s, conducting research when requested, preparing reports and presenting findings, attending meetings, and training volunteers and personnel.
  • Assists Animal Services managers with staff evaluations and performance reviews of zookeepers, interns and volunteers in assigned area.
  • Educates the public by conducting tours, providing information, and giving presentations when required.
  • Assists in staff training and education for employee development, setting team goals and implementing policies and implementing work plans with Animal Services managers.
  • Responsible for upholding organizational policy.
  • Recognizes signs of pest infestation in animal areas and follows standard pest control protocols as directed.
  • Ability to communicate work instructions, directions and organizational policy clearly and effectively.
  • Other duties as assigned.
